Organizational Basics

Who else would we turn to for organizational tips than the queen of organizing, Martha Stewart. Naturally, she’s got a few tips to help you get organized. Among her many suggestions are these gems: store your linens (separated by acid-free paper) in acid-free boxes, your holiday items in color-coded bins, and leave your glasses unstacked. She also recommends that you go through everything at least once a year and donate those things you don’t need. Read more at marthastewart.com.

Basket Case

We came across some great plans for a laundry basket dresser over at ana-white.com. Talk about an easy way to clean up and organize a room. Each case holds four laundry baskets and can be made from one sheet of plywood. Throw on some paint and you’ve got a stylish solution to your organizational issues.
